Thomas B. Fordham Institute: Majority states have "mediocre to awful" science standards
Submitted by Tommy Cornelis on February 2, 2012
According to a new report from the Thomas B. Fordham Institute found that a majority of states have “mediocre to awful” science standards and curriculum. This report includes individual report cards and analysis for each state. Unfortunately only six states managed to earn A’s in The State of State Science Standards 2012.
